CHARLOTTE – Premier Inc., a healthcare improvement company, has announced the addition of Virginia Commonwealth University Health System to its network.

VCU Health is a Level I trauma center verified in adult, pediatric and burn trauma care located in Richmond, Va.

Premier said VCU Health will have access to its supply chain services, including its group purchasing organization and advanced analytics.

“We look forward to partnering with VCU Health to further strengthen their approach to consistently attaining top level performance,” Michael J. Alkir, president of Premier, said in a press release Monday.

The financial impact of the agreement was not disclosed.

Premier offers pharmacy integration and technology designed for value-based care to more than 4,000 hospitals and health systems.
